Transaction 34f64d7c61736ab8d66d681b1bccbeb8071f4f391a420499a2c2df09b1e985a8

1 Input
2 Outputs
  • 34f64d7c61736ab8d66d681b1bccbeb8071f4f391a420499a2c2df09b1e985a8:0
  • value  51036194
    address  18dfLRHAogX5KAuebgic8AEAsAh5yjLAPS
  • 34f64d7c61736ab8d66d681b1bccbeb8071f4f391a420499a2c2df09b1e985a8:1
  • value  16188000
    address  38cfSMwgMgMKm4qKW2uYbpoBCBHBiU5YdQ